Renaissance Technologies LLC, founded in 1982 by mathematician James Simons as Monemetrics and headquartered in East Setauket, New York, is a legendary quantitative hedge fund managing around $65 billion in assets as of late 2024, renowned for its pioneering use of mathematical models and algorithms in trading. Starting with currency trading and evolving into a secretive powerhouse under its flagship Medallion Fund—launched in 1988—the firm employs PhDs, physicists, and computer scientists to analyze vast datasets, executing high-frequency trades across equities, futures, and derivatives with returns averaging over 66% annually before fees from 1988 to 2018. Simons, who stepped down as chairman in 2021, built a culture of intellectual rigor, limiting Medallion to employees and insiders since 1993 while offering institutional funds like the Renaissance Institutional Equities Fund (RIEF) to outsiders. Now led by Peter Brown and Robert Mercer’s successors, Renaissance remains a benchmark for quant investing, blending academic precision with a low-profile, extraordinarily profitable legacy despite occasional regulatory scrutiny.

Renaissance Technologies's Q4 2018 Portfolio in Review

As of Q4 2018, Renaissance Technologies held 3,847 positions worth $91.3B, down 6.1% from $97.3B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 9.1% of the portfolio.

Renaissance Technologies deployed $8.84B of net new capital in Q4 2018, opening 522 new positions and adding to 1,588 existing holdings. Its largest new stake was Apple: 11,041,936 shares worth $435M.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Healthcare at 15% of assets, down from 18% a quarter earlier, followed by Technology and Financials.

On the sell side, the largest reduction was Dell, an estimated $332M trimmed.
